Joel Osteen
TUESDAY, JULY 17, 2007
Posted by: Crossgar Free Presbyterian Church | more..
121,700+ views | 3 user comments
BLOG ON: SERMON Joel Osteen
Crossgar Free Presbyterian Church
Rev. Gordon Dane
Christianity Today reported Joel Osteen's London's Wembly Arena appearance of 7 July. They said Joel gave a message about living a positive life in God’s favour. “You need to see yourself the way you want to be,” he encouraged the crowd. “It’s not enough to see it - you need to learn to say it.” This is an example of the "Name it and claim it message he preaches. The problem is this is not a message found in the Bible.
